About Program
Through Diploma in Commercial Practice (Lateral Entry), lateral entry students can strengthen their technical base and build practical competence in administration, services and business operations. It explains core concepts, teaches documentation, office systems, service coordination, accounts support, records, customer handling and workplace communication and prepares students to handle supervised technical responsibilities in industry. It is suitable for students who want employment-ready training, higher education options and related course pathways in the same technical area.

Required Documents
Required documents for Diploma in Commercial Practice (Lateral Entry) should support lateral entry admission in administration, commercial practice, hospitality, logistics or service-focused diploma education.
• Class 10 mark sheet and certificate for date of birth, basic academic record and identity verification.
• Qualifying lateral entry document such as ITI, 10+2 vocational, 10+2 science or other eligible technical qualification, as accepted by the competent authority.
• Computer, office practice, accounting, hospitality, logistics or service-training certificates may be considered where relevant to the program.
• Recent passport-size photographs, scanned signature and valid government photo ID such as Aadhaar card, voter ID, passport or driving licence.
• Transfer certificate, migration certificate, character certificate or gap certificate, if required by the admitting institute or counselling authority.
• Caste, category, EWS, income, disability, domicile or residence certificate, if reservation, scholarship, fee concession or state quota is being claimed.
• Counselling registration slip, allotment letter, application form, fee receipt and original documents for final verification at the institute.
